你这个图片和描述的问题不符啊,这是编辑器的设置界面啊,如果代码运行后乙非零代码退出,上面有详细的说明,指出代码错误的位置,是什么类型的错误,按提示检查改正就可以了
运行没有问题,python解释器退出,如果代码有问题,会抛出异常,没有问题时,释释器退出默认为0的,等同...
python 返回非零 python非零返回1非零返回python 1. os模块一些常见的函数:# 获得系统信息 os.uname() ('Linux', 'sjpt-hdwxnew-33.wxxdc', '4.4.0-142-generic', '#168-Ubuntu SMP Wed Jan 16 21:00:45 UTC 2019', 'x86_64') # 获得现在进程的真正用户 os.getuid() 1000 # 获得现在的PID ...
通常你可以在主窗口输入一个文件结束符(Unix 系统是 Control-D,Windows 系统是 Control-Z)让解释器以 0 状态码退出。如果那没有作用,你可以通过输入 quit() 命令退出解释器。 Python 解释器具有简单的行编辑功能。在 Unix 系统上,任何 Python 解释器都可能已经添加了 GNU readline 库支持,这样就具备了精巧的交互编...
Python为什么非零返回 python3非零返回 前面给大家分享了Python的数据结构,是每一位Python程序猿必须理解的内容,也是面试官最喜欢问的范畴;今天我们了解下Python的流程控制:条件语句和循环语句。if 条件语句,语句形式:if 条件1:语句1elif 条件2:语句2else:语句3这三个关键词的行尾必须跟冒号(:)实例代码:f-str ...
在程序中,当Python检测到一个错误时,解释器就会指出当前流程已无法继续执行下去,这时就出现了异常。例如,使用print()函数输出一个未定义的变量值,具体如下所示: 在Python程序中,如果出现异常,而异常对象并未被捕获或处理,程序就会用自动的回溯,返回一种错误信息,并终止执行,上述语句返回的错误信息如下: 上述信息提示...
SubprocessError的子类,当一个被check_call()或check_output()函数运行的子进程返回了非零退出码时被抛出。 returncode 子进程的退出状态。如果程序由一个信号终止,这将会被设为一个负的信号码。 cmd 用于创建子进程的指令。 output 子进程的输出, 如果被run()或check_output()捕获。否则为None。
在特定条件下,可以使用os._exit()函数直接终止Python解释器进程。这将导致整个作业失败并终止执行。例如: 代码语言:txt 复制 import os def my_function(): # 函数逻辑 if some_condition: # 当满足某些条件时使作业失败 os._exit(1) else: # 函数正常执行完毕 return result my_function() ...
>>>提示输入代码。要退出Python解释器返回终端,可以输入exit()或按Ctrl-D。 运行Python程序只需调用Python的同时,使用一个.py文件作为它的第一个参数。假设创建了一个hello_world.py文件,它的内容是: print('Hello world') 你可以用下面的命令运行它(hello_world.py文件必须位于终端的工作目录): ...
进程使用的内存地址可以限定使用量(比如火车上的餐厅,最多只允许多少人进入,如果满了需要在门口等,等有人出来了才能进去)-“信号量(semaphore)” Python全局解释器锁GIL 全局解释器锁(英语:Global Interpreter Lock,缩写GIL),并不是Python的特性,它是在实现Python解析器(CPython)时所引入的一个概念。由于CPython是大...